#9e8358 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#9e8358 is composed of 62% red, 51.4% green and 34.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 17.1% magenta, 44.3% yellow and 38% black. It has a hue angle of 36.9 degrees, a saturation of 28.5% and a lightness of 48.2%. #9e8358 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ffb0 with #3d0700. Closest websafe color is: #999966.

#9e8358 color description : Mostly desaturated dark orange.

#9e8358 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#9e8358 has RGB values of R:158, G:131, B:88 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.17, Y:0.44, K:0.38. Its decimal value is 10388312.

Shades and Tints of #9e8358

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#070604 is the darkest color, while #fcfbf9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#9e8358

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#827d74 is the less saturated color, while #f39603 is the most saturated one.
